1800 Draped Bust Dollar, AU53
B-19, BB-192, 'AMERICAI'

1800 $1 AMERICAI, B-19, BB-192, R.2, AU53 PCGS. Bowers Die State II. One of two so-named "AMERICAI" varieties -- this one with a backwards J-shaped die break that mimics an "I" after the final A in AMERICA.. Obverse die clashing shows "waves" above and below the date. Iridescent colors play beneath attractive, silver-gray toning on this sharply struck example. Only scattered, tiny marks and a hint of wear account for the About Uncirculated grade. The field stars are uniformly sharp, while strong rims and dentils surround both sides. Eye appeal is excellent.

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 24X9, Variety PCGS# 40082, Base PCGS# 6892, Greysheet# 199152)

Weight: 26.96 grams

Metal: 89.24% Silver, 10.76% Copper
